Company Summary

Blue Team is a US-based provider of national disaster recovery, remediation, reconstruction, renovation, and roofing services for commercial properties. Our core business focuses on cleanup and mitigation efforts for recovery from fire damage, roof leaks, flooding, pipe bursts, and post-disaster remediation due to severe weather. We exclusively serve commercial sectors including hospitality, senior housing, healthcare, commercial offices, municipalities, multifamily living, and institutional markets.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ES Purchasing
  • Works with Project Manager to ensure good decisions for the company and project during the buyout process.
  • Assists PM in completing project buyout.
  • Assists in preparation of complete subcontract Scope of Work.
  • Fully reviews drawings & specifications in preparation of subcontractor scope.
  • Understands contract documents and identifies gaps in the systems.
Project Closeout
  • Performs pre-punch list walk thru with PM and Superintendent.
  • Makes closing out the project a priority.
  • Enforces contract close-out timeline and notifies subcontractors.
  • Works with Project Manager in collecting all close out documents.
  • Works with Accounting to close out all financials.
  • Performs other duties as needed.
Teamwork
  • Shows respect for duties of other team members.
  • Supports and interacts with Project Manager and Field Supervision to perform as a cohesive team.
  • Participates in weekly OAC and subcontractor meetings.
  • Reviews project bulletins and identifies scope of work changes.
  • Coordinates local city permit and utilities company requirements as related to subcontractors and owner requirements.
  • Can identify quality issues in the field and communicate them accordingly.
  • Performs other duties as needed.
Project Schedule
  • Distributes overall project schedule as defined by the PM and Field Supervisor. Monthly (min).
  • Will take necessary actions to maintain or improve project schedule.
Project Safety
  • Actively assists project superintendent with enforcement of site safety
Owner Relationships
  • Proactively thinks about owner issues.
  • Handles clients’ needs with a sense of Urgency.
  • Adapts to different client's individual personalities, needs, and wants.
  • Handles misc. owner requests without objection.
  • Participates in Owner, Architect Contractor (OAC) meetings.
  • Understands and exceeds client expectations.
Subcontractor Management
  • Maintains open communication with subcontractors.
  • Works with PMs and Superintendents to recognize underperforming subcontractors timely with project notifications.
  • Reviews subcontractors change order proposals for accuracy of quantities, conformance with contract documents and subcontractor scope of work.
Documentation
  • Maintains & assists PM with preparation of Weekly Project Updates accurately and on time.
  • Maintains and updates Purchasing Schedule and Submittal Log.
  • Reviews submittals for conformance to contract documents.
  • Identifies lead times for materials purchases and tracks delivery dates.
  • Maintains and updates Subcontractor Change Order Log.
  • Maintains and updates Owner Change Order Log.
  • Maintains and updates RFI Log.
  • Generates subcontractor meeting agendas and minutes.
  • Accurate and timely documentation of project issues.
  • Fully uses Procore for every project.
  • Reviews project documents & creates RFIs in a timely manner.
